The SAP error message
/ISDFPS/FDPDAHHM308 Cannot determine logical system of the central domestic system
typically occurs in the context of SAP's Foreign Trade or Logistics modules, particularly when dealing with data related to customs or foreign trade processes. This error indicates that the system is unable to identify the logical system associated with the central domestic system, which is necessary for processing certain transactions or data.Causes:
- Missing Configuration: The logical system for the central domestic system may not be configured in the system settings.
- Incorrect Settings: The settings for the logical system may be incorrect or incomplete.
- Transport Issues: If the system has recently undergone a transport or upgrade, the necessary configurations may not have been transported correctly.
- Master Data Issues: There may be missing or incorrect master data related to the logical system.
Solutions:
Check Logical System Configuration:
- Go to transaction
SPRO
and navigate to the relevant configuration settings for Foreign Trade or Logistics.- Ensure that the logical system for the central domestic system is defined correctly.
Define Logical System:
- If the logical system is not defined, you can create it in transaction
SALE
(Logical System Name).- Ensure that the logical system is assigned to the appropriate client.
Check Customizing Settings:
- Verify that all necessary customizing settings related to the foreign trade or logistics processes are correctly set up.
- This includes checking the settings for the customs declaration and related processes.
Review Master Data:
- Ensure that all relevant master data (such as vendor, customer, and material master records) is correctly maintained and linked to the logical system.
Transport Requests:
- If the issue arose after a transport, check the transport logs to ensure that all necessary objects were transported successfully.
- Re-transport any missing configurations if necessary.
Consult Documentation:
- Review SAP documentation or notes related to the specific module you are working with for any additional guidance or known issues.

SAP messages fall into 3 different categories: Error messages
(message type = E), Warnings (W) or Informational (I) messages.
An error message will prevent you from continuing your work - it is a hard stop and you need to fix the error before you can proceed. A warning message will stop your work, however, you can then bypass the warning by pressing the Enter key on your keyboard. That said, it is still good practice to investigate the cause of the warning message and address it. An information message will not stop your work and is truly just for informational purposes.
